Originally bred as working dogs to manage rodents in textile mills, Yorkshire Terriers are fierce small creatures with a powerful instinct to terriers. If they are introduced at an early age, they are great companions for people who live in a home that is not shared with pets of their own. Yorkies can be aggressive towards other animals, and they need to be monitored by children since they are hardwired to chase them. Yorkies are renowned for their spirited personalities and their enthusiasm to participate in canine sports like agility.

While they are more active indoors than many other breeds, Yorkies still need a daily walk and some play time outdoors to keep them entertained. They are a great choice for apartments since they don't require a lot of space and can fit well in most homes. They aren't prone to shed, but their silky, long coats do need regular brushing.

As a toy dog Yorkshire Terriers tend to be less robust physically than larger breeds and are more prone to health problems. These can include hypoglycemia, a condition where the liver cannot properly store sugar and the blood begins to crash, and dental issues arising from overcrowded teeth that cause gum disease. They also are at risk of respiratory problems such as collapsed tracheas, and heart conditions like portosystemicshunts where abnormal blood flow bypasses liver and causes toxic buildup.

Yorkies are extremely smart and eager to please, which makes them easy to train. They are also social dogs who are awestruck by attention and have strong bonds with their owners. This is why they are not suitable for those who want to be a lap dog, as they prefer to be engaged in activities rather than lying on the couch and relax.

Characteristics

Yorkies are playful, spirited and can be very feisty. They can be excellent companions for older people and are also great with children, so long as the youngsters are properly supervised.

The dog's fearless and confident nature can make it difficult to train but it's doable when you persevere. Positive reinforcement is a method that works well with this loyal family dog, which develops strong bonds with its owners.

These toy-sized terriers were developed to combat vermin problems in mills, and they possess a strong hunting instinct. This means they can't always play well with larger dogs and may consider them prey. They can also be destructive in the first two years of life and are likely to eat whatever they come across which is why it is essential to keep an eye on them to ensure they don't ingest something harmful.

Health

Yorkshire Terriers, just like all dogs, require an excellent diet to remain healthy and content. They thrive on small quantities of commercial canned dog food or kibble designed for "all life stages" and made with high-quality ingredients. The diets are recommended to be supplemented with skin and coat supplements, fish oil, and vitamins to support heart, kidney, and joint health. A dental-focused diet may be suggested by a veterinarian to help keep Yorkies from developing gum disease.

Training

Yorkies are smart dog breeds that can be trained with a strong work ethic and an obstinacy that makes them difficult to housetrain and learn tricks. Positive reinforcement and consistent training is essential to the success of this breed. Inscribing your dog into obedience training classes will provide the discipline and structure that a Yorkie needs.

These small dogs have strong bonds with their owners and are eager to be loved by their owners. They may become jealous if they are separated from their owners for too long. They also tend to be watchdogs who bark when something is wrong. They are good with children of any age however they can be a bit irritable when children are rude or play rough.

They require moderate exercise and love walks or romps in a fenced-in yard However, they can also have most of their physical requirements fulfilled through indoor play. They are generally well-behaved with other pets, but they may be cautious around cats and small dogs. If they aren't taught to accept these animals they could become aggressive and even bite.

If you decide to purchase a Yorkshire Terrier from a responsible breeder, be sure to request health certificates. The most frequent health issues for this breed include cataracts, liver disease, and patellar luxation (loose knee joints). A breeder who does not have these certificates is at higher risk of selling you a dog that has serious health issues that could cost you thousands of dollars in surgeries and ongoing medication.

In addition to liver and eye illnesses, Damian Der welpe Yorkshire Terriers are prone to develop diabetes. This is due to the pancreas ceasing to produce insulin, which regulates sugar and fat metabolism within the body. This condition is easily observed in pets as a result of excessive thirst, weight gain, and increased the frequency of urination.
